Transaction aadcbe18ae31ee2192750a5476cd69c212884a3dbc59ab20c8ca2dd1d4d7766f
1 Input
1 Output
-
aadcbe18ae31ee2192750a5476cd69c212884a3dbc59ab20c8ca2dd1d4d7766f:0
- value
- 8438949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af292ec3cf04ea0f980c1648b7660aaf46e690e1 OP_EQUAL
- address
- 3HfBWY57RYUdZdTw8hd9yLZZUJpTn78Gtu